body {min-width: 1400px;margin:0 auto; font-size:16px; font-family: "宋体" "微软雅黑"; color:#000;background: #f6f6f4;}
*{margin:0 auto;padding:0;list-style-type:none;border: 0;/*letter-spacing:0.5px*/ }
a {text-decoration:none; color:#4a4a4a;border:0;font-size: 18px;}
img{border:0;}
a:hover {text-decoration:none; overflow:hidden;/* color:#ff0700;*/}
ul{ margin:0px auto; padding:0px; list-style-type:none;}
/*li{ width:95%; line-height:33px; padding-left:28px; background: url(../images/fangkuai.jpg) no-repeat 10px 19px;}*/
.top01m .topjz .list{width: 220px !important;}
.top01m .topjz .right{width: 935px !important;}
.top01m .topjz {width: 1240px !important;}

.tbgd {width: 100%; height: 102px;position: fixed;top: 0px;z-index: 999;transition: top 0.3s ease; /* 添加过渡效果，使隐藏和显示更平滑 */  }
.gdwz{width: 100%;height: 70px;font-size: 20px;margin: 0 auto;background: #fff;border-bottom: 2px #dbd9db solid;position: sticky;z-index: 999;}
.logo {width: 1240px;height: 70px;margin: 0 auto;}
.logo .z{float: left;width:335px;height: 50px;margin-top:10px ;}
.logo .z p{float: right;font-size: 22px;line-height:50px;color: #000;}
.logo .y{float: right;width: 780px;height: 50px;margin-top:10px ;}
.logo ul{float: right;}
.logo ul li{float: left;line-height: 50px;font-size: 20px;}
.logo ul .li{padding: 0 12px;}
.logo .y ul li a{text-decoration:none;}
.gh {width: 350px;height:105px;position: absolute;top: 0px;right:560px;}

.banner{width: 100%;height:540px;margin: 0 auto;position: relative;padding-top:115px;}
.tit01 {opacity: 1;width:1100px;height:450px;margin: 0 auto;background:url(http://www.huaian.gov.cn/images/ztzl/2025/2025lh/cio_ban_list.png) no-repeat top center; }



.list_bj{margin-bottom: 40px;background:url(http://www.huaian.gov.cn/images/ztzl/2025/2025lh/banner_b.jpg) no-repeat top center;}
.neir{width: 1280px;height: auto;background: #fff;border-radius:5px;/*box-shadow:0px 0px 15px #ccc;*//*margin-top: 105px;*/}
.neir .posi{text-align: left;width: 1110px;height: 60px;line-height: 60px;/*margin-top:180px ;*/padding-left: 35px;border-bottom: 1px solid #ccc;}
.zhengw{width: 1280px;min-height:530px ;margin-top: 15px;}
.zhengw ul{width: 1150px;min-height:425px;margin: 0 auto;}
.zhengw ul li{line-height: 60px;background: url(http://www.huaian.gov.cn/images/ztzl/2024/ggzqjj/ico_1.jpg) no-repeat left;transition: padding 0.5s ease;padding-left:30px;font-size: 18px;border-bottom: 1px dashed #ccc;}
.zhengw ul li span{float: right;color: #565252;font-size: 16px;margin-right:0px;transition: margin-right 0.5s ease;}
.zhengw ul li:hover{padding-left: 40px;}
.zhengw ul li:hover a{color: #e22311;font-weight:bold ;display: block;}
.zhengw ul li:hover span{margin-right: 15px;color: #c31316;}
.page-wrap{text-align: center;margin-top: 25px;padding-bottom: 22px;}
.dqwz{width:1150px ;height:80px;border-bottom: 1px solid #338bf4;}
.dqwz p{line-height:80px ;}
.dqwz a{font-size:16px ;color: #4a4a4a;line-height:40px ;line-height:85px ;}
.dqwz a:hover{color: #c31316;}

/*content 开始*/
.zhengw h1 {width: 1150px;line-height: 40px;text-align: center;font-family: "微软雅黑" "宋体", ;font-size: 34px;font-weight: bold;color:#333 ;margin-bottom:20px;}
.zhengw h2 {width: 1150px;font-size: 14px;line-height: 40px;color: #999;text-align: center;border-bottom: 1px solid #CCCCCC;font-weight: normal;margin-bottom:30px;}
.nr-wz3{font-size: 16px;line-height: 36px;color: #555;width: 1150px;min-height:200px;overflow-x: hidden;text-align: justify;text-justify: inter-ideograph;}

.nav_subOn{color: rgb(226,35,17) !important;}
.zhengw h2 a{font-size:14px ;}


/*----------------------------PC版分页样式2022----------------------------------------*/
.page-wrap a {border-radius:5px;font-family: Microsoft Yahei;color: #fff;background: #355e92;padding: 5px 10px;font-size: 13px;}
.page-wrap a:hover {color:#fff; text-decoration:none;background:#2d76d1;}
.page-wrap .s2 {background:#c00;}
.page_input{ margin: 0 10px; line-height: 25px; height: 25px; border: 1px solid #ccc; }
.page-wrap .submit{ border: 0px; border-radius: 5px; font-family: Microsoft Yahei; color: #fff; background: #c00000; padding: 5px 10px; }









/*----------------------------footer----------------------------------------*/
.footer-wrap{width: 100%; background-color: #e8e8e8;  padding-bottom:30px;padding-top: 20px; font-size:18px ;clear: both;}
.footer{width: 1200px; margin: 0 auto;}
.footer .link2 {position: relative;}
.footer .link2 p{text-align: center; line-height: 36px; padding-top: 20px;}
.footer .link2 .mk1{position:absolute; left: 5px; top: 20px;}
.footer .link2 .mk2{position:absolute; left: 123px; top: 26px;}
.footer .link2 .mk3{position:absolute; right:80px; top: 32px;}
.footer .link2 .mk4{position:absolute; right:5px; top: 20px;}

